About this school

Sikeston Junior High School is a State/Public serving middle age pupils, located in Sikeston, Scott County. The school has 511 pupils enrolled. It is part of the Sikeston R-6 school district. It serves grades 7โ€“8 in a small-town setting. The school employs 38.7 full-time-equivalent teachers, a student-teacher ratio of 13.2:1. 29% of students are proficient in reading. 33% are proficient in maths. Technology infrastructure includes fiber internet, campus-wide Wi-Fi, devices for students.

Free & reduced-price lunch

508 of the school's 511 students (99%) qualify for free or reduced-price lunch. Of these, 508 qualify for free lunch and 0 for a reduced price. The school participates in the National School Lunch Program. Free and reduced-price lunch eligibility is a widely used indicator of the share of students from lower-income households.

School setting & status

Town, DistantGrades 7โ€“8Title I

Sikeston Junior High School is located in a small-town setting (NCES locale: Town, Distant). The school runs a schoolwide Title I program, which provides federal funding to support students from low-income families. School district: SIKESTON R-6

Sikeston Junior High School is one of 8 schools in SIKESTON R-6, based in SIKESTON, Missouri. The district serves 3,277 students district-wide and employs 251 full-time-equivalent teachers. With 511 students, Sikeston Junior High School is larger than the district average of about 410 students per school.
